Woman Using Sign Language To Tell Deaf Dog Her Owner’s Home Amazes Internet

Summary

A video showing a deaf dog named Myla responding to sign language has become popular online. Myla, a blue heeler mix, used sign language to understand that her owner was coming home. The video has gained over 1.4 million views on TikTok.

Key Facts

  • Myla is a deaf blue heeler dog, also called an Australian cattle dog mix.
  • Her owner used sign language to tell Myla that her owner was arriving home.
  • The video of Myla’s reaction has over 1.4 million views and more than 84,300 likes on TikTok.
  • Myla's deafness was discovered by her owners after noticing she didn't respond to sounds.
  • At 3 years old, Myla knows some American Sign Language and owner-created signals.
  • The video received many positive comments praising Myla’s intelligence and the bond with her owners.
  • Blue heelers are known for their intelligence and are sometimes called clever dogs.
